I’ve hit a very unexpected wrinkle… the hotel does not store luggage! Not only does the hotel not store luggage, there is no left luggage at CVG!
A goodly amount of searching has turned up nothing, the recommended locations and lockers are either full or closed. This was definitely not part of the plan :( Where there’s a will there’s a way. IHG Status offered later check out and I’ve negotiated them to 2pm from an original lowball offer of noon :D Now to check out day rooms or even hotel rooms near the airport. I’d rather chill in a room for a few hours than end up bag-dragging around the city or camping out in departures. |
Happily party source was selling alcohol at 10:30 am and I’ve picked up the 10yo Basil Hayden that was high on my want list for this trip. I only saw it for sale in the UK once for nigh on £300 so £70 is a price I’m happy to pay. Also picked up some of the flavoured moonshine minis as I keep seeing these deeply discounted on Amazon but never been willing to pay out for a full bottle blindly.
https://cimg0.ibsrv.net/gimg/www.fly...aefe6ea82.jpeg The rollaboard is now solidly packed so I’ll have to pin my hopes on duty free for the last two bottles. Even if I strike out I’ll be happy :) Time to switch hotels, I’ve picked up a day room at the airport Hilton for £50. |
